Understanding Cell and Gene Therapies
Genetic interventions and cell-based treatments signify two separate but often synergistic fields of therapeutic advancement:
✅ Regenerative Cell Medicine encompasses the infusion, alteration, or administration of functional cells into a host to manage a disease. This includes hematopoietic cell therapy, genetically enhanced T-cell treatment for cancer, and stem-based healing methods to repair injured cells.
✅ Genomic Treatment focuses on altering or optimizing defective DNA within a biological blueprint to neutralize genetic disorders. This is achieved through biological or chemical methods that transfer genetic material into the body’s cells.
These treatments are ushering in a paradigm change where maladies that were once handled with endless pharmaceuticals or invasive procedures could theoretically be resolved with a definitive solution.
Viral Vectors
Microbes have developed to effectively introduce genetic material into host cells, rendering them a powerful mechanism for DNA-based treatment. Frequently employed biological delivery agents include:
Adenoviral vectors – Designed to invade both proliferating and non-dividing cells but can elicit host defenses.
Parvovirus-based carriers – Favorable due to their minimal antigenicity and potential to ensure extended DNA transcription.
Retroviral vectors and lentiviral systems – Embed within the host genome, providing stable gene expression, with HIV-derived carriers being particularly useful for altering dormant cellular structures.
Alternative Genetic Delivery Methods
Alternative gene transport techniques offer a reduced-risk option, reducing the risk of immune reactions. These comprise:
Liposomes and Nanoparticles – Packaging DNA or RNA for efficient intracellular transport.
Electropulse Gene Transfer – Employing electrostimulation to create temporary pores in plasma barriers, permitting nucleic acid infiltration.
Targeted Genetic Infusion – Administering DNA sequences straight into specific organs.
Applications of Gene Therapy
DNA-based interventions have proven effective across multiple medical fields, profoundly influencing the treatment of hereditary diseases, malignancies, and infectious diseases.
Gene-Based Solutions for Hereditary Conditions
Many genetic disorders result from monogenic defects, rendering them suitable targets for gene therapy. Some notable advancements comprise:
CFTR Mutation Disorder – Efforts to introduce corrective chloride channel genes have demonstrated positive outcomes.
Clotting Factor Deficiency navigate here – Gene therapy trials seek to reestablish the biosynthesis of coagulation proteins.
Dystrophic Muscle Disorders – Genome engineering via CRISPR provides potential for individuals with DMD.
Sickle Cell Disease and Beta-Thalassemia – DNA correction techniques aim to rectify red blood cell abnormalities.
Oncological Genetic Treatment
DNA-based interventions are crucial in tumor management, either by altering T-cell functionality to eliminate cancerous growths or by directly altering cancerous cells to inhibit their growth. Some of the most promising cancer gene therapies feature:
Chimeric Antigen Receptor T-Cell Engineering – Modified lymphocytes attacking tumor markers.
Oncolytic Viruses – Engineered viruses that selectively weblink infect and eradicate cancerous growths.
Reactivation of Oncogene Inhibitors – Reviving the activity of genes like TP53 to regulate cell growth.
Treatment of Infectious Conditions
Genomic medicine presents possible remedies for ongoing illnesses such as viral immunodeficiency. Experimental techniques incorporate:
CRISPR-Based HIV Intervention – Directing towards and neutralizing HIV-infected units.
Genetic Engineering of White Blood Cells – Transforming T cells protected to disease onset.

Comprehending Cell and Gene Therapies
Genetic and cellular advancements embody two distinct but typically interwoven divisions within the healthcare industry:
Regenerative Cell Therapy involves the infusion, adaptation, or injection of biological cells into an individual to remedy disorders. Some key methods involve regenerative stem cell techniques, Chimeric Antigen Receptor T-cell therapy, and biological rejuvenation methods to repair damaged tissues.
DNA-Based Therapy is dedicated to modifying or replacing defective genetic material within biological DNA for correcting gene-based illnesses. This is achieved through vector-based or non-vector gene transfer that place corrective sequences inside human tissues.
Such treatments are ushering in a healthcare transformation where genetic issues earlier mitigated with persistent pharmaceutical use or extensive surgeries might have lasting solutions through one-time therapy.
Decoding the Principles of Regenerative Medicine
Exploring Cell Therapy: The Future of Medicine
Tissue restoration techniques utilizes the renewal abilities of cellular functions to address health conditions. Major innovations encompass:
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plants (HSCT):
Used to manage oncological and immunological illnesses by reviving marrow production with healthy stem cells.
CAR-T Cell Therapy: A groundbreaking oncology therapy in which a patient’s T cells are modified to better recognize and eliminate neoplastic cells.
Multipotent Stromal Cell Therapy: Studied for its capability in managing autoimmune diseases, orthopedic injuries, and neurodegenerative disorders.
Genetic Engineering Solutions: Restructuring the Genetic Blueprint
Gene therapy achieves results by correcting the root cause of DNA-related illnesses:
In Vivo Gene Therapy: Transfers modified genes directly into the biological structure, such as the regulatory-approved vision-restoring Luxturna for managing inherited blindness.
External Genetic Modification: Utilizes editing a biological samples outside the body and then implanting them, as evidenced by some experimental treatments for hemoglobinopathy conditions and immune deficiencies.
The advent of gene-editing CRISPR has rapidly progressed gene therapy scientific exploration, making possible precise modifications at the genetic scale.
Cutting-Edge Advancements in Therapeutics
Cell and gene therapies are advancing treatment paradigms across multiple fields:
Oncology Solutions
The authorization of T-cell immunotherapy like Kymriah and Yescarta has changed the landscape of cancer treatment, with significant impact on cancer sufferers with aggressive lymphomas who have not responded to conventional therapies.
Inherited Syndromes
Medical issues for example a genetic neuromuscular disorder as well as sickle cell disease, that historically provided scarce medical solutions, currently feature revolutionary genetic treatments for example a pioneering SMA treatment and a cutting-edge genetic correction method.
Brain-related Diseases
Genomic solutions is actively researched for cognitive impairments including Parkinson’s disease alongside Huntington’s disease, as numerous scientific assessments indicating promising successes.
Unusual and Specialized Ailments
Considering roughly thousands of specialized medical cases affecting a vast population globally, cellular and genetic treatments bring groundbreaking possibilities where conventional healthcare has been insufficient.
